See the License for the specific language governing permissions and limitations under the License. --%> <%@ taglib prefix="my" uri="http://tomcat.apache.org/jsp2-example-taglib"%> <html> <head> <title>JSP 2.0 Examples - jsp:attribute and jsp:body</title> </head> <body> <h1>JSP 2.0 Examples - jsp:attribute and jsp:body</h1> <hr> <p>The new &lt;jsp:attribute&gt; and &lt;jsp:body&gt; standard actions can be used to specify the value of any standard action or custom action attribute.</p> <p>This example uses the &lt;jsp:attribute&gt; standard action to use the output of a custom action invocation (one that simply outputs "Hello, World!") to set the value of a bean property. This would normally require an intermediary step, such as using JSTL's &lt;c:set&gt; action.</p> <br> <jsp:useBean id="foo" class="jsp2.examples.FooBean"> Bean created! Setting foo.bar...<br> <jsp:setProperty name="foo" property="bar"> <jsp:attribute name="value"> <my:helloWorld/> </jsp:attribute> </jsp:setProperty> </jsp:useBean> <br> Result: ${foo.bar} </body> </html>
